Output 4101db4e7ce7ddb86abf79f30a5f35d422ec0413a6bf6f62681310c93e3b26e3:3

value
307428
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b14f043278478120ed39b8e2e8d33165cace27bb OP_EQUAL
address
3HrYBeqM33bYxF4r7XeM4eXybbLs7fP7U5
transaction
4101db4e7ce7ddb86abf79f30a5f35d422ec0413a6bf6f62681310c93e3b26e3
spent
true